Web6 apr. 2024 · Blocked Tear duct or Sticky eyes is a very common problem in babies and infants. First of all, we should know what is tear duct. It is a thin passage in the corner of every eye, which drains the tears down to the nasal cavity, that is why our nose feels running when we cry. Newborns don’t gets tears when they cry, around for first 1-2 months.
